Transaction 978eb4375cc636c8078e65e9aa59fbb994a61a5d18176d0664d2513608b55205

1 Input
2 Outputs
  • 978eb4375cc636c8078e65e9aa59fbb994a61a5d18176d0664d2513608b55205:0
  • value  100600
    address  1P4JCPVuhvkUzSvnGLHgGAADFMiAEcWJs6
  • 978eb4375cc636c8078e65e9aa59fbb994a61a5d18176d0664d2513608b55205:1
  • value  2917
    address  34KaLSvVYGwpG6nhWHGBcvnshyAKAJHrG1